Pet Dog Daycare Vs Pet Dog Park
Dog daycare offers your animal with normal socializing in a risk-free and controlled atmosphere. This can help them to construct count on, find out just how to connect with pets of all dimensions and individualities, and pick up on canine body language.
While pet dog parks might seem like a terrific area for your dog to burn off some energy, they have lots of concealed hazards.
Safety and security
Dog parks and canine day care are both great spaces for puppies to work out and mingle, but they differ in safety functions. Pet dog park settings are uncertain, and a bad experience can have long-term impacts on your pet dog's self-confidence and actions.
Pet daycare offers a safe and structured atmosphere, where canines are positioned in groups that match their characters. The center has actually experienced team who keep track of play to stop injuries. Although battles do take place periodically, they are generally minor and are not a result of aggressiveness.
An additional safety and security feature of pet day care is that staff members are responsible for implementing guidelines and making certain that pets are immunized. This is important because pet dogs in not being watched settings might be revealed to pathogens in feces or alcohol consumption water, and this can bring about conditions like kennel coughing, giardia, fleas, and various other bloodsuckers. They might likewise be subjected to hostile pets, which can create severe damage to puppies and young adults.
Socialization
Canine parks offer the perfect off-leash environment for pets to launch energy and fraternize various other animals. They additionally offer a great location for dogs to work out, which is a vital part of their general wellness. Pet childcares, on the other hand, provide an extra structured and risk-free setting for your pet dog to communicate with other animals in a much more regulated fashion.
Pets that are not exposed to other dogs in a positive method on a regular basis might create anti-social actions which can manifest as worry, stress and anxiety or hostility towards various dog boarder near me other pets. Dogs that spend time at the canine park generally just recognize one mode of interaction with other canines-- high drive play up until they are worn down.
When pets fulfill at a dog park, the greetings are typically frantic with each canine rushing to get to the other. This can result in scuffles or fights. At a well-run day care, first introductions are generally sniffing butts and the workers stay in control of the interaction guaranteeing no scuffles happen.

Atmosphere
Dog parks supply outside play in a natural setup, which offers physical exercise and possibilities for canines to engage in their all-natural habits like sniffing and running. This can help in reducing stress and anxiety, advertise socializing, and improve psychological excitement.
However, outside play areas are prone to disease-spreading conditions such as looseness of the bowels and Giardia due to guide call between pets. Additionally, the environment might not be clean adequate to prevent contamination from canines' feces or urine.
At childcare, the centers are cleaned up frequently and sanitized frequently to decrease these risks. Furthermore, specialist day cares separate dogs based upon size, personality, and playing style to stop harmful communications. Canines that have no organized activities in the house can experience boredom, which commonly leads to habits concerns such as extreme barking and eating. Daycare supplies an active, engaging setting that networks pets' power right into positive activities and boosts their behavior in your home and in public setups. It also aids to alleviate splitting up anxiousness and tension in homes with pets that are laid off throughout the day.
